Augmented 4th/ Diminished 5th Ascending

The augmented 4th is an interval that spans four notes on the musical staff.  The diminished 5th spans five notes on the musical staff.  While they have different names these two intervals are the same size. They are both made up of 6 semitones or 3 whole tones, which is why they can be called a Tritone. It can be practiced the following ways.

Moveable Do:                       

Fa-Ti or Ti-Fa

Song References:                

Maria (West Side Story), The Simpsons Theme

Scale Degree Numbers:   

4-7 or 7-4

*Fun Fact - the tritone was historically considered the Diabolus in musica (devil in music) because it was considered a dissonant or unharmonious sound
